Cross Cultural Learner Centre

Cross Cultural Learner Centre CCLC is a community organization that exists to provide settlement services and support to newcomers and to promote intercultural awareness and understanding.

Fully funded summer camp spots are available for eligible children ages 7 to 15 from newcomer families.

Through a partnership with Thames Valley District School Board, eligible children can attend:

YMCA Day Camp in London
• Outdoor adventure at Fanshawe Conservation Area or Spencer Lodge
• Canoeing, kayaking, nature play, crafts and games
• Spencer Lodge is available by public transportation

Overnight Camp at Camp Queen Elizabeth
• 2-week island camp experience in Georgian Bay
• Canoeing, sailing, archery, campfires and more
• Transportation by bus is available

Camp fees are covered. Extra help with clothing and equipment may also be available.

Learning about the history of Indigenous Peoples is an important part of understanding Canada.

Our newcomer clients recently participated in a Canadian First Nations Information Session featuring the Blanket Exercise, an interactive experience that explores the histories, experiences, and resilience of Indigenous Peoples through storytelling, reflection, and discussion.

As a settlement agency, we are committed to creating opportunities for newcomers to learn, connect, and deepen their understanding of the communities they now call home.

Meet our keynote speaker, Alfredo Caxaj! 🌎

From newcomer to community leader, Alfredo’s story embodies the spirit of this year’s Life As A Refugee event: resilience, belonging, and the power of community.

As Founder and Co-Artistic Director of SunFest, Alfredo has helped shape one of Canada’s premier celebrations of world cultures, bringing people together through music, art, food, and storytelling for nearly three decades.

His journey, leadership, and impact on London’s multicultural community have inspired thousands across the city and beyond. We are honoured to welcome him as this year’s keynote speaker.
